Remarks:
The sculpture was funded by the Georgia Council for the Arts and the Carrollton Parks, Recreation, and Cultural Arts Department. It is sited in a Japanese garden, designed by the artist and landscape architect Bob Watkins. Sidney Garner of Lee Fabricators helped with the fabrication; welding was done by
Ralph
Mullins
. The sculpture is designed to gently rock with the forces of nature, wind and rain. IAS files contain related newsclipping from the Times Georgian, April 1989, pg. 3C.
